Hey, thanks for watching the video. 1. Yes, you are absolutely right, you have to apply visa only 30 days prior to your travel date. The Singapore visa can only be applied through some selected agents like Makemytrip, AkbarTravels etc. and you don't need to book your flights and hotels, these travel agencies can show dummy tickets for you and once your visa is approved you can make the actual bookings. 2. I don't think getting visa for your parents would be a problem since you have good bank balance. Moreover, visa only gets rejected if the application is not filled properly or the visa counsellor believes that you won't come back to your home country. I hope this helps.
